February 12, 2002 - Opening of Parliament convergence of refugee activists
Plans are underway to converge at Parliament House in ACT (from 8am) to highlight Australia's rotten refugee policy. The idea was originally floated by Rural Aust for Refugees and seems to have been taken up by the NGO network and the Greens. The bulk of the activities are scheduled from 12-2pm. It seems that the NGO network is preparing stunts aimed at grabbing media attention - including a mock trial. Activists from all over Aust can show the polies we'll be following them!
